WebSep 9, 2024 · On August 19, HHS authorized all state-licensed pharmacists and pharmacy interns to order and administer vaccines for patients aged 3 through 18 years in an effort to increase access to childhood vaccines and decrease the risk of … WebWhat immunizing pharmacists need to know 1. Pharmacists must follow the Oregon pharmacy protocols for vaccine administration 2. Immunizations given must be reported to the Oregon Immunization Information System, ALERT IIS.
